本文目录导读:
虚拟专用服务器(Virtual Private Server,简称VPS)是一种将物理服务器分割成多个虚拟机以供独立使用的云计算技术,它通过虚拟化技术实现了资源的隔离和分配,使得每个虚拟机可以像一台独立的物理服务器一样运行。
什么是VPS?
VPS是一种基于共享硬件资源但又能实现独立操作系统环境的计算模式,在VPS中,一个物理服务器被划分成多个虚拟机,每个虚拟机都拥有自己的操作系统内核、应用程序和网络接口等资源,这些虚拟机之间相互隔离,不会互相干扰或影响彼此的性能。
VPS的工作原理
-
硬件层:VPS依赖于底层的物理服务器硬件,包括CPU、内存、存储设备和网络接口卡等,这些硬件资源由云提供商管理并提供给客户使用。
图片来源于网络,如有侵权联系删除
-
虚拟化层:这是VPS的核心组成部分之一,负责将物理服务器的资源进行抽象化和封装,常见的虚拟化技术有KVM(Kernel-based Virtual Machine)、Xen和VMware ESXi等,它们能够创建和管理多个独立的虚拟机实例,并为每个实例分配必要的资源。
-
操作系统层:在每个虚拟机上安装了一个完整的操作系统,如Linux或Windows,这个操作系统能够独立于其他虚拟机运行,并且具有自己的文件系统、进程管理和网络配置等功能。
-
应用层:在这个层面上,用户可以在各自的虚拟机上部署各种应用程序和服务,例如Web服务器、数据库管理系统、电子邮件服务器等。
-
网络层:VPS通过网络连接到互联网或其他内部网络环境中,通常情况下,每个虚拟机都有一个专用的IP地址,允许外部访问其上的服务和数据。
-
安全层:为了保护数据和隐私不受未经授权的访问,VPS通常会采用多种安全技术措施,如防火墙规则、入侵检测系统和加密通信协议等。
-
监控与管理层:管理员可以通过远程桌面工具或者命令行界面来监控和管理所有的虚拟机状态,确保系统的稳定性和安全性。
VPS的优势
-
成本效益高:相比于购买和维护多台物理服务器,使用VPS可以显著降低运营成本。
-
灵活性强:可以根据业务需求动态调整资源分配,满足不同场景下的性能要求。
-
可扩展性好:随着业务的增长,可以轻松地添加更多的虚拟机以满足日益增加的计算需求。
图片来源于网络,如有侵权联系删除
-
可靠性高:由于采用了冗余设计和故障转移机制,一旦某个虚拟机发生问题,另一个备用实例会立即接管工作,从而保证了服务的连续性。
-
易于维护:集中化的管理和统一的更新策略简化了日常运维工作。
VPS的应用场景
-
网站托管:适合小型和中型企业的静态网页或博客站点;也适用于需要较高并发处理能力的电子商务平台。
-
开发测试环境:为软件开发团队提供一个快速搭建的开发环境和测试环境,便于团队成员之间的协作和交流。
-
游戏服务器:用于在线多人游戏的实时交互和数据同步。
-
流媒体服务:支持视频点播、直播等大流量传输的业务类型。
-
大数据分析:利用强大的计算能力和存储空间进行数据处理和分析。
VPS作为一种高效、经济且灵活的服务器解决方案,已经成为现代企业和个人用户的常见选择之一,随着技术的不断进步和发展,相信未来会有更多创新的应用案例涌现出来。
标签: #vps服务器原理
评论列表